Did a little research about One Step Beyond
(Series announcer) "John Newland and One Step Beyond became synonymous with each other, much like" (Rod) "Serling did with The Twilight Zone. Like Serling, Newland was a straight shooter. He didnt force a world view or insist you believe. He often opened his show by stating that even though what we were about to see was based on real testimony, the final say on whether it was true or not lay solely on the viewer. He invited belief, but he never demanded it. He posed questions, but he did not force or impose answers. There was no manipulation intended. It would go against good storytelling. Instead, Newland would simply ask people to think about each story so they could formulate their own opinions."
